Good luck with your planned pregancy. From what I have seen the increase in thryoid meds is usually by 25 - 40%.
You should discuss with your Dr. in advance of getting pregnant. I also understand that the increase in thyroid meds will start pretty soon after conception.
Make sure your TSH is at optimal level (I think usually around 1) before you TTC.
